You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
52 lines
1.3 KiB
52 lines
1.3 KiB
define(['jquery', 'bootstrap', 'backend', 'form', 'table'], function ($, undefined, Backend, Form, Table) {
|
|
|
|
var Controller = {
|
|
index : function () {
|
|
$("input:radio[name='row[auto]']").change(function (){
|
|
var auto=$("input:radio[name='row[auto]']:checked").val();
|
|
if(auto == 1){
|
|
$('.auto').show();
|
|
}else{
|
|
$('.auto').hide();
|
|
}
|
|
|
|
}).trigger('change');
|
|
|
|
$("input:checkbox[name='row[genjing]']").change(function (){
|
|
var auto=$("input:checkbox[name='row[genjing]']:checked").val();
|
|
if(auto == 1){
|
|
$('.genjing').show();
|
|
}else{
|
|
$('.genjing').hide();
|
|
}
|
|
|
|
}).trigger('change');
|
|
$("input:checkbox[name='row[chengjiao]']").change(function (){
|
|
var auto=$("input:checkbox[name='row[chengjiao]']:checked").val();
|
|
if(auto == 1){
|
|
$('.chengjiao').show();
|
|
}else{
|
|
$('.chengjiao').hide();
|
|
}
|
|
|
|
}).trigger('change');
|
|
$("input:radio[name='row[leadauto]']").change(function (){
|
|
var auto=$("input:radio[name='row[leadauto]']:checked").val();
|
|
if(auto == 1){
|
|
$('.leadauto').show();
|
|
}else{
|
|
$('.leadauto').hide();
|
|
}
|
|
|
|
}).trigger('change');
|
|
|
|
Form.api.bindevent($("form[role=form]"));
|
|
},
|
|
wechat : function () {
|
|
|
|
Form.api.bindevent($("form[role=form]"));
|
|
}
|
|
|
|
};
|
|
return Controller;
|
|
});
|